Oyo State government has lifted the curfew imposed on 10 local government areas following the recent kidnapping incident in Oriire.
In a statement issued by the commissioner for Information, Prince Dotun Oyelade, on Saturday, asked the residents to resume their normal activities. At the same time, the government expressed appreciation for the cooperation and understanding of the people in the affected areas.
Oyelade added that the government was closely monitoring the security situation and reassured residents that efforts were ongoing to end the kidnapping episode.
It would be recalled that the government initially imposed a 16-hour curfew on the affected communities, which was later extended by an additional one-day curfew on Thursday.
